SUBCHAPTER F - MATCHING SCHOLARSHIPS TO RETAIN STUDENTS IN TEXAS
SECTION/RULE §22.114 - Eligible Students
Chapter Review Date 01/31/2020

To be eligible to receive an award through this program, a student must:(1) be a resident of Texas;(2) provide proof to the Texas institution that he or she has been offered a non-athletic scholarship or grant, including an offer of payment of tuition, fees, room and board, or a stipend, by an out-of-state institution; and(3) have been accepted for admission to the out-of-state institution offering the assistance.

Source Note: The provisions of this §22.114 adopted to be effective August 27, 2018, 43 TexReg 5509.
